I take the Deputy's point. There is a distinct issue here on country to country reporting which is an issue Ireland supports and is actively supporting. The commentary in Article 6.1 clearly outlines that the country does not need to be asked for the information before the information is provided. I am satisfied that sufficient provisions are in place to allow for the spontaneous exchange of information. I also take the point that further standards are required at an OECD level on the spontaneous exchange of information. Ireland is playing a leading role in this. I am confident that sufficient provision is made to allow for information that has not been requested to be provided.
